On Wed, 29 Jun 2005, Michele Perry wrote:
I am trying to recon a sagittal T1 series from a functional scan, originally in AFNI format. I converted it to COR using mri_convert -it brik /path/to/<file>.BRIK $SUBJECTS_DIR/subjid/mri/orig
The first run of recon-all -stage1 (-nomotioncor) exited with errors (mri_fill exited with non-zero status). It said that the cerebellum may be attached and then had messages related to rh and lh wm seed points so I ran recon-all with -cc-xyz, -rh-xyz, -lh-xyz and -pons-xyz. That finished without errors. When I tried csurf after that, the wm was mainly in the cerebellum, not a whole lot anywhere else.
I was advised to check the T1 to make sure the T1 wm intensities were close to 110. Those intensities are close to 110.
Any idea what might be wrong with this data or with my processing? Thank you for your help, Michele
